Workshops in Chennai are increasingly adopting silent air compressors over traditional ones for several practical and strategic reasons:
🔧 Key Benefits Driving the Shift
Noise Reduction: Silent compressors significantly lower ambient noise, creating a more comfortable and safer work environment for technicians and customers alike.
Energy Efficiency: Many silent models use advanced motor technology that consumes less power, helping workshops cut down on electricity bills.
Lower Maintenance Costs: These compressors often have fewer moving parts and better cooling systems, reducing wear and tear and extending service intervals.
Improved Productivity: A quieter workspace allows for better concentration and communication among workers, which can lead to faster turnaround times.
Cleaner Operation: Silent compressors are often oil-free or have better filtration systems, which means less contamination in air-powered tools and cleaner output.
🏭 Why It Matters in Chennai
Urban Density: With workshops located in crowded neighborhoods, minimizing noise pollution is both a regulatory and community-friendly move.
Client Experience: Many auto and fabrication workshops are becoming more customer-facing, and a quieter environment enhances professionalism.
Tech Adoption: Chennai’s growing startup and manufacturing ecosystem is pushing for modern, efficient tools that align with global standards.
